Best time to move

Moving companies typically charge 20–30% more between Memorial Day and Labor Day (peak season). October through April offers the lowest rates and better mover availability.

To avoid mid-semester school transfers, most U.S. families schedule moves between mid-June and mid-August. Public school calendars typically run late August or early September through late May or early June.

Winter driving along this route

  • Donner Pass (I-80) and Tejon Pass (I-5 Grapevine) see chain requirements and occasional closures December through March.
  • I-17 and I-40 through the Flagstaff area can see winter closures; the rest of Arizona is generally clear year-round.
  • Raton Pass (I-25 at the Colorado line) can close in winter storms.

State DOT 511 phone or web services provide real-time road conditions year-round.

When is the best time to move from Norman to Fresno?

Moving companies usually charge 20–30% less between October and April (off-peak). Memorial Day through Labor Day is peak pricing. For a 1479 mi drive, weather on the route matters too — see the timing section above for state-specific winter warnings.

What is the climate difference between Norman and Fresno?

On NOAA 1991–2020 normals, annual average temperature is 65.0°F in Fresno vs 60.7°F in Norman (4.3°F warmer). Annual snowfall: 0.0 in vs 4.1 in. Annual precipitation: 11.0 in vs 37.7 in.

Is Fresno more expensive than Norman?

Based on BEA Regional Price Parities (2024), overall price level in Fresno is 13.0% higher than Norman (102.158 vs 90.408, U.S. average = 100). Rent and services typically carry most of this gap.
